    A long way to go still to this rally but...

    we know for sure that Ogier will definitely start 1st even if he gets 0 from Estonia.

    Evans from second seems also quite sure, although Thierry has a chance to pass him but that would require another very bad result from Evans.

    Now it gets very interesting, because who sill start from 3rd and onwards on the road is very open, Tänak is just 8 points away from Neuville and Taka is 11 points away from him and Kalle is 21 points away.

    so Rally Estonia result will be pretty crucial considering starting positions 3 and onwards.

    Tickets for sale now. Very expensive though.

    Ticket for Monday test: 12 euro
    Ticket for Thursday non prio shakedown: 18 euro
    Ticket for Friday prio shakedown: 25 euro
    Ticket for half the stages of the rally: 98 euro

    Catastrophic floods in large parts of Belgium, the Netherlands and Germany. Search and rescue operations ongoing in lots of cities and villages. Also the area around the circuit Spa-Francorchamps is hit hard (Sunday stages Ypres Rally). The village of Spa is flooded. There's damage to the supporting infrastructure of the circuit and also the road from Blanchimont to the paddock has collapsed. The circuit organisation has said that they will prepare the circuit for this weekend already, but I don't know if the rest of the roads will be affected. Anyhow, terrible events right now in a beautiful part of the country. I just hope everyone stays safe there.
